Overview of Spectrum Internet Assist Program

Spectrum Internet Assist is an initiative designed with the goal of making reliable, high-speed internet accessible to households with limited income. Recognizing the vital role that online connectivity plays in today's society, Spectrum has established this program to help bridge the digital divide and ensure that more families have the opportunity to participate in the digital economy, complete educational assignments, seek employment, and more.

Through the Spectrum Internet Assist program, qualifying customers can enjoy affordable access to the internet without compromising on service quality. Spectrum's low-income internet service is provided at a reduced cost, while still maintaining the speeds and reliability needed to support essential online activities.

Spectrum’s Affordable Connectivity Program (ACP)

Spectrum has aligned with federal initiatives to further support households struggling with internet affordability. The Affordable Connectivity Program (ACP) is a federal benefit program aimed at ensuring that low-income families and individuals have access to the internet services they need to work, learn, and carry out key activities in today’s digital world.

Under this program, Spectrum offers enhanced benefits beyond the scope of its already-established Internet Assist program. Clients who are eligible for ACP may receive additional discounts on their internet services, reducing the financial burden and bridging the connectivity gap for those in need. Comparative Analysis with Other Providers' Low-Income Services

Each low-income internet service provider has unique qualifying criteria, internet speeds, pricing, and additional benefits. For instance, providers like Comcast's Internet Essentials and AT&T's Access program also offer reduced internet service rates for low-income families. Yet, speed and coverage may differ substantially between these programs and Spectrum's offering.

Spectrum's Internet Assist provides consistent speeds that are often higher than the basic tiers of other programs, which can be a significant advantage for households with multiple users or for those who require more bandwidth for activities such as streaming or online work.
